Important Evidence for a Personal Injury Claim

When building an effective personal injury claim, it is important to put together adequate evidence demonstrating negligence and the extent of your damages. Important evidence for a personal injury claim includes photographs of the accident scene and your injuries, witness statements and affidavits, medical records, and your own written narrative outlining how the incident occurred.

Having these types of evidence can clearly paint a picture for a judge or jury to determine negligence and proper compensation for any damages suffered by an individual. It is critical to gather this evidence early on in order to build a strong legal argument for one’s case. Now let`s discuss how medical records specifically play a role in building an effective personal injury claim in the next section.

Medical Records

Medical records are a vital element of any personal injury claim, as they provide objective evidence that an injury occurred and the medical treatment required. It is important to obtain detailed documentation of all medical expenses incurred, such as doctor`s visits, lab tests, MRI scans and hospitalization. This information should be used to prove the nature and extent of the injury and any resulting disability or pain and suffering. Documenting expenses can also be important in recovering future treatment costs or lost income due to missed work.

When seeking compensation for a personal injury claim, having evidence to support your case is essential. Medical records provide details about the diagnosis and prognosis of an illness or injury, including how it was treated and its long-term effects. This information can help build a strong case when negotiating with insurance companies or taking legal action against a negligent party.

Collect the Relevant Documents

It is important to ensure the most accurate evidence for your personal injury claim. Collecting all relevant documents is a key element of that process. Documents such as medical records, reports from specialists or related medical professionals, estimates and invoices from repairs or property damage, and receipts for out-of-pocket expenses are all critical in providing proof of your level of damage and injury caused by an incident.

In some cases, statements from witnesses or experts may also be appropriate to collect in order to show you have a valid case. For instance, if you are bringing an assault case against another person, collecting witness statements can help to corroborate your story with facts and details which bolster your legitimacy. Further documents such as photos, videos, audio clips, or even text messages which demonstrate the cause of injury may also be useful additions to the collection process.

Ultimate Guide to Storm Preparation for Trees in FloridaUltimate Guide to Storm Preparation for Trees in Florida

Expert Tips for Tree Safety

Ensuring Young Trees Thrive

To safeguard your Property and ensure the longevity of your young trees during Florida’s stormy seasons, it’s crucial to take specific measures:

  1. Stake Young Trees Properly: Drive stakes deep into the ground and use strong rope to secure them. This will provide the necessary support to withstand strong winds.
  2. Regular Checks: Frequently inspect the stakes and ropes, ensuring they are secure and in good condition.

By following these steps, you enhance storm preparation for trees in Florida, significantly reducing the risk of damage.

Prune Weak or Dead Branches

Maintaining healthy trees involves regular pruning, which is vital for storm preparation for trees in Florida. Here’s how:

  • Identify Weak Branches: Look for branches that are brittle, dead, or weak.
  • Prune Effectively: Use proper tools to trim these branches back to their base, reducing the chance of breakage during a storm.

Professional Pruning Services

Hiring Professional arborists for regular tree pruning not only beautifies your landscape but also provides an essential safety measure during storm preparation for trees in Florida. Professionals know exactly how to trim for health and safety, ensuring your trees are less likely to suffer storm damage.

Avoid the Pitfalls of Tree Topping

Understanding the Risks

Tree topping, also known as “hat racking,” is an extreme form of pruning that involves removing most of the tree’s foliage. Here’s why it’s detrimental:

  • Internal Rot: The tree becomes susceptible to rot, which can lead to splitting or falling.
  • Legal Issues: In many areas, tree topping is illegal due to its harmful effects.

Proper Pruning Practices

Pruning Essentials for Different Trees

Palm Trees: Minimal Maintenance

Palm trees are well-suited to Florida’s climate and generally require minimal storm preparation. However, certain precautions can still be beneficial:

  • Remove Coconuts and Seeds: Large fruits and seeds can become dangerous projectiles in high winds.
  • Inspect Regularly: Ensure the tree is healthy and free from pests or disease.

Trees with Thick Canopies

Trees with dense foliage need regular thinning to reduce wind resistance and potential damage. This is a key aspect of storm preparation for trees in Florida:

  • Regular Thinning: Reducing the canopy’s density helps wind pass through, minimizing breakage.
  • Monitor Growth: Trees with multiple trunks need careful monitoring and selective pruning to ensure stability.

Emergency Tree Care Kit

Prepare an emergency tree care kit for immediate action post-storm:

  • Essential Tools: Include a handsaw, pruning shears, and a hatchet.
  • Safety Gear: Ensure you have gloves, safety glasses, and a first-aid kit.

Regular Inspections

Consistent inspections are vital for effective storm preparation for trees in Florida:

  • Monthly Checks: Inspect trees monthly for signs of disease or damage.
  • Post-Storm Assessments: After a storm, evaluate the condition of your trees and perform necessary maintenance.

FAQs

How often should I prune my trees?

Pruning should be done at least annually, but frequency may increase depending on the tree species and specific weather conditions in Florida.

Can I prune my own trees?

While minor pruning can be done by homeowners, it’s advisable to hire professionals for significant pruning tasks to ensure proper techniques and safety.

What should I do if a tree is damaged during a storm?
